Nicodemi Montepulciano Abruzzo Le Murate 2021
Montepulciano is the wine we have been producing since 1977. With the 2014 harvest we chose to produce it with the Montepulciano d’Abruzzo Colline Teramane DOCG denomination as an authentic testimony of the link between a territory and its grape variety. "Le Murate", an ancient hamlet of Notaresco, is born from the selection of grapes from our old Abruzzo pergola vineyards of the early 1970s and vineyards that are about 15 years younger.

Colour

Intense ruby.

Bouquet

Nose of black cherries, blackberries and currants at first sight, then rose petals and a slight aroma of black pepper.

Flavour

The tannin is soft and the wine is voluminous on the palate. Savouriness perfectly melted in the structure with a sour note to make it fresh and long.

Pairing

Excellent with seasoned cheeses, and first courses with strong condiments such as meat sauce, amatriciana and carbonara. To accompany roasts and grilled meat.

Features

Name Nicodemi Montepulciano Abruzzo Le Murate 2021
Type Red organic still
Classification DOCG Montepulciano d'Abruzzo Colline Teramane
Year 2021
Size 0,75 l Standard
Alcohol content 13.50% by volume
Grape varieties 100% Montepulciano
Country
Region Abruzzo
Origin Notaresco (TE).
Climate Altitude: 250-300 m. a.s.l. Exposure: East/South-East.
Soil composition Medium-textured clayey limestone.
Cultivation system Guyot, pergola abruzzese.
No. plants per hectare 1,600-5,000
Yield per hectare 9,000 kg/h.
Harvest By hand.
Vinification Destemming and slight crushing followed by 6-7 days of maceration on the skins. Racking. Alcoholic fermentation conducted at a controlled temperature in steel vats.
Ageing 30% of the wine is transferred into small 225 liter barrels of second-pass French oak where spontaneous malolactic fermentation takes place and matures for 4 months. Assembling of the wine matured in steel and the one matured in wood, bottling after light filtration.
Allergens Contains sulphites
